Hearing aid prices vary widely based on several factors. On average, a pair may cost between $2,000 and $8,000. What's most important is to remember you are going to be seeing your provider for 3 - 5+ years. Do you feel the Hearing Specialist is there to support you or just trying to sell you a set of hearing aids? Do you prefer to work with a large chain or a small business where you get more personal care?
Weigh price vs service.

Yes, hearing aids can help with tinnitus—especially when the tinnitus is associated with hearing loss, which is common.
